Output 50b089de03645951e854f37cd9efd72aff14a7be38aff67ef36752a2e6821254:622

value
2011
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ab71349bae6d9f876c287128c621c835791e719d5df87407647714a8dbd507b2
address
bc1p4dcnfxawdk0cwmpgwy5vvgwgx4u3uuvathu8gpmywu223k74q7eqslyfgl
transaction
50b089de03645951e854f37cd9efd72aff14a7be38aff67ef36752a2e6821254
spent
true